按以下步骤用softICE调试WIN2000下的WDM:(1)启动Symbol Loader;(2)菜单"FILE-OPEN",选择要调试的card.nms;(3)菜单"MODULE-LOAD",加载要调试的nms文件;之后,按ctrl+D... 全文

2004-02-12 16:25 来自版块 - 非USB硬件驱动开发

我是一只菜鸟。请问:PCI-to-Local地址空间开辟了有什么用?如果我的CS0上接了一块有寄存器的芯片,我要是访问我的这些寄存器,是从PCI-to-Local地址空间的基地址访问呢,还是从系统分配的CS0基地址空间访问呢?

2004-02-12 13:34 来自版块 - 非USB硬件驱动开发

各位大侠: 我是一只菜鸟。请问: PCI-to-Local地址空间开辟了有什么用?如果我的CS0上接了一块有寄存器的芯片,我要是访问我的这些寄存器,是从PCI-to-Local地址空间的基地址访问呢,还是从系统分配的CS0基地址空间访问呢?

2004-02-11 16:25 来自版块 - 非USB硬件驱动开发

按以下步骤用softICE调试WIN2000下的WDM:(1)启动Symbol Loader;(2)菜单"FILE-OPEN",选择要调试的card.nms;(3)菜单"MODULE-LOAD",加载要调试的nms文件;之后,按ctrl+D... 全文

2004-02-11 16:19 来自版块 - 非USB硬件驱动开发

有两个问题想向高手们请教: 9052: (1)PCI-to-Local地址空间0的Range、remap、desc有什么用? (2)上面的空间和Chip Select0的基地址和Range是一回事吗?我现在LOCAL端只接了一个chip到CS0。板已经调出来了还... 全文

2004-02-07 16:23 来自版块 - 非USB硬件驱动开发

又是DeviceIoControl惹的祸应用程序中置数,驱动中接收到后立刻返回该数,但是数就变了,为什么?请各位老大援手,以下是程序段:驱动:NTSTATUS ThinDevice::READ_DATA_Handler(KIrp I){NTSTATUS status;UCHAR ... 全文

2004-01-13 21:43 来自版块 - 非USB硬件驱动开发

测试的应用程序返回的数据很古怪:当驱动中希望返回0x00~0x7F时,应用程序返回的是0x00~0x7F;而当驱动中希望返回>0x7F,例如期望返回0xAF时,应用程序返回的却是0xFFFFFFAF.为什么会变呢?DeviceIoControl函数究竟怎么用才正确呢?以下是... 全文

2004-01-13 19:34 来自版块 - 非USB硬件驱动开发

现在我也有几个问题等着解决,请高手不吝赐教:(1)用DeviceIoControl传数,当希望读回0x00~0x7F时,应用程序正确的读回了,但以后的数前面都有一个0xFFFFFF**,不知道为什么,请各位大侠给以指导。如果有例程就好了。(2)用m_IoPortRange0和m_... 全文

2004-01-11 18:50 来自版块 - 非USB硬件驱动开发

现在我也有几个问题等着解决,请高手不吝赐教:(1)用DeviceIoControl传数,当希望读回0x00~0x7F时,应用程序正确的读回了,但以后的数前面都有一个0xFFFFFF**,不知道为什么,请各位大侠给以指导。如果有例程就好了。(2)用m_IoPortRange0和m_... 全文

2004-01-11 16:04 来自版块 - 非USB硬件驱动开发


返回顶部